Output d633cf0392ed4c66e245df6d7a638b58a0a327b3d57f37381208bcd8b468ce25:1

value
53174192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d938727869d3e9894ca4d21abfeb267873e2b2a OP_EQUAL
address
32voSTaKy7zWQ1SPdvAMEoHS7dbqFzEdfM
transaction
d633cf0392ed4c66e245df6d7a638b58a0a327b3d57f37381208bcd8b468ce25
spent
true